Title: Paint for Pinto Emblem
Post by: dave1987 on December 28, 2008, 11:39:25 PM
What type of paint should I use to touch up a Pinto emblem with the red white and blue "P" insert? If anyone knows or has done this already, exactly what paints did you use?
Title: Re: Paint for Pinto Emblem
Post by: Tercin on December 29, 2008, 09:20:27 AM
I used some Testors model paint, it looks okay. You can tell what I did when you get up close. I tried a red Sharpie as well, it has faded some and it is in the garage.

Tercin
Title: Re: Paint for Pinto Emblem
Post by: Fred Morgan on December 29, 2008, 11:34:33 AM
My daughter painted these 3 yrs. ago with automotive touch up paint called dupli-color. I gave her another 23 to paint up.  Fred   :)
